*** CHEMICAL IDENTIFICATION ***
RTECS NUMBER : UX2800000
CHEMICAL NAME : Pyrogallol
CAS REGISTRY NUMBER : 87-66-1
BEILSTEIN REFERENCE NO. : 0907431
REFERENCE : 4-06-00-07327 (Beilstein Handbook Reference)
LAST UPDATED : 199806
DATA ITEMS CITED : 37
MOLECULAR FORMULA : C6-H6-O3
MOLECULAR WEIGHT : 126.12
WISWESSER LINE NOTATION : QR BQ CQ
COMPOUND DESCRIPTOR : Tumorigen
Drug
Mutagen
Reproductive Effector
Human
Primary Irritant
SYNONYMS/TRADE NAMES :
* Benzene, 1,2,3-trihydroxy-
* 1,2,3-Benzenetriol
* C.I. 76515
* C.I. Oxidation Base 32
* Fouramine Brown AP
* Fourrine PG
* Fourrine 85
* Pyrogallic acid
* 1,2,3-Trihydroxybenzen
* 1,2,3-Trihydroxybenzene

** ACUTE TOXICITY DATA **
TYPE OF TEST : LDLo - Lowest published lethal dose
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E : Oral
SPECIES OBSERVED : Human
DOSE/DURATION : 28 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- convulsions or effect on seizure threshold
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- dyspnea
Gastrointestinal - other changes
REFERENCE :
34ZIAG "Toxicology of Drugs and Chemicals," Deichmann, W.B., New York,
Academic Press, Inc., 1969 Volume(issue)/page/year: -,507,1969
TYPE OF TEST : LDLo - Lowest published lethal dose
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E : Subcutaneous
SPECIES OBSERVED : Human - man
DOSE/DURATION : 120 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- convulsions or effect on seizure threshold
Behavioral - excitement
Gastrointestinal - changes in structure or function of salivary glands
REFERENCE :
ZMWIAJ Znetralbaltt fuer die Medizinischen Wissenschaften. (Berlin,
Germany) Volume(issue)/page/year: 19,545,1881
